About Joanne M. Devlin

Joanne M. Devlin is a scholar working on Epidemiology, Infectious Diseases, Agronomy and Crop Science, Parasitology and Animal Science and Zoology, having authored 127 papers that have together received 2.1k indexed citations. Recurring topics across this work include Herpesvirus Infections and Treatments (68 papers), Animal Disease Management and Epidemiology (23 papers), Cytomegalovirus and herpesvirus research (21 papers), Animal Virus Infections Studies (18 papers), Viral gastroenteritis research and epidemiology (15 papers), Viral Infections and Vectors (15 papers), Vector-borne infectious diseases (14 papers) and Viral Infections and Immunology Research (13 papers). The work is most often cited by research in Endocrinology (268 citations), Microbiology (316 citations), Agronomy and Crop Science (451 citations), Epidemiology (1.3k citations) and Parasitology (259 citations). Joanne M. Devlin has collaborated with scholars based in Australia, South Korea and United Kingdom. Frequent co-authors include Glenn F. Browning, Amir H. Noormohammadi, Carol A. Hartley, James R. Gilkerson, Mauricio J. C. Coppo, Paola K. Vaz, Alistair R. Legione, Nino Ficorilli, Sang‐Won Lee and Philip F. Markham. Their work appears in journals such as PLoS ONE, Avian Pathology, Vaccine, Journal of Wildlife Diseases and Australian Veterinary Journal.
